And so I am going to dive first into some research background by Dr Ian Stevenson, who is actually a former psychiatrist who devoted over 40 years of researching reincarnation among children. I think we've kind of all heard like if you've experienced this yourself as a child, maybe your kids, or maybe you've heard about another child who shared kind of these weird stories as a young one, that makes you go like wait, what did you just say? And we can't help but wonder where that's coming from, right. And so Dr Ian Stevenson has actually done a lot of groundbreaking research and science on this work, through numerous thousands of case studies, working with children and the children remembering their past lives and also having the physical peculiarities that match those previous lives. And so a lot of the cases that he has done has been confirmed from death reports. And so he worked with children between the ages of about two to five, um, and working with their memories that surface then, uh, I would say that he has shared that usually those memories begin to start to fade away for us around the age of six. But he has verified the facts and the claims in more than 1500 cases, which is so fascinating. So definitely look him up if you're curious about any of this.

Amanda O'Mara:

But I will share one story that he shares with us, which is the story of James Leninger, who started having nightmares at about the age of two years old, of a plane crash that was shot down in war I think it was a war between the American, the Americans and the Japanese and he would tell his parents what was going on with these nightmares and that, how he was one of the pilots in that plane and he would even draw pictures of planes burning and crashing. And this kid even knew, like his name from that past life, his friend's name, his co-pilot, the name of the plane and like so many other details. It was so interesting, and so they were able to dive into this case study and find the history of of these, these men that had died in a plane crash. And they actually found it, and they were able to find the story and the sister of that person who had passed, and she was able to confirm all the details, like even um, I forget her name, but like she would only go by a specific name, and this kid like confirmed, like no, I used to call you this, and so, yeah, it's pretty, pretty fascinating story.
